大家好,今天小编关注到一个比较有意思的话题,就是关于java编程数字全部排列顺序的问题,于是小编就整理了4个相关介绍Java编程数字全部排列顺序的解答,让我们一起看看吧。
JAVA数组排序几种排序方法详细一点?
这是平时经常用到的排序方法整理,简单易懂
快速排序:首先是最简单的Array.sort,直接进行排序:
public static void main(String[] args) {
int[] arr = {4,3,5,1,7,9,3};
Arrays.sort(arr);
大家好,今天小编关注到一个比较有意思的话题,就是关于java编程数字全部排列顺序的问题,于是小编就整理了4个相关介绍Java编程数字全部排列顺序的解答,让我们一起看看吧。
这是平时经常用到的排序方法整理,简单易懂
快速排序:首先是最简单的Array.sort,直接进行排序:
public static void main(String[] args) {
int[] arr = {4,3,5,1,7,9,3};
Arrays.sort(arr);
for (int i : arr){
System.out.println(i);
}
2、部分排序法:使用Array.sort还可进行选择想要排序的部分数字,如将下角标编号为1~4的数字进行排序,其他数字顺序不变。
要输出1到100的数字可以使用数组来实现。首先,创建一个包含100个元素的数组,然后使用循环来为每个元素赋值。在循环中,可以使用一个计数器来迭代1到100,并将对应的值赋给数组元素。
最后,可以使用一个循环遍历数组并将其中的元素输出到控制台或者其他输出设备上。这样就能够输出1到100的数字了。从1到100这么多数字,如果不使用循环和数组的话会很麻烦,而使用数组和循环不仅简单方便,而且便于扩展和修改代码。所以使用数组输出1到100的数字是一种高效且可维护的方法。
在编程中,我们通常使用数组来存储一系列相关的数据。在许多编程语言中,包括J***a、Python、C++等,都有数组这种数据结构。下面我将以J***a和Python两种语言为例,演示如何使用数组输出1到100。
J***a:
j***a
复制
int[] array = new int[100];
for (int i = 0; i < array.length; i++) {
array[i] = i + 1;
}
for (int i = 0; i < array.length; i++) {
System.out.println(array[i]);
}
这段J***a代码首先创建了一个长度为100的数组,然后通过循环将1到100的整数依次存入数组。最后,再次通过循环将数组中的元素打印出来。
Python:
这段Python代码使用内置的range函数生成1到100的整数序列,然后通过list函数将其转换为列表(在Python中,列表相当于数组)。最后,通过循环将列表中的元素打印出来。
数字前后批量加内容后转文本的方式如下:
1. 手动转换,最简单的方法是手动将数字转换成文本形式。我们可以根据数字的大小和位数,逐个将数字的每一位转换成对应的汉字或其他文字。
2. 编程脚本转换 。对于大量数字的批量转换,编程脚本是一个更好的选择。我们可以使用编程语言如Python、J***a等来编写相应的脚本,实现数字文本转换的自动化。
3. 在线工具转换 除了编程脚本,还有一些在线工具可以帮助我们进行数字批量转换文本。这些在线工具通常提供友好的用户界面,我们只需输入要转换的数字范围,选择转换规则。
J***A有三大分类,分别为:J2ME、J2SE、J2EE。J***a ME是一种高度优化的J***a运行环境,主要针对消费类电子设备的,例如蜂窝电话和可视电话、数字机顶盒、汽车导航系统等等。
J***A ME技术在1999年的J***aOne Developer Conference大会上正式推出,它将J***a语言的与平台无关的特性移植到小型电子设备上,允许移动无线设备之间共享[_a***_]。扩展资料:J***a2平台包括:标准版(J2SE)、企业版(J2EE)和微缩版(J2ME)三个版本。J2SE,J2ME和J2EE,这也就是SunONE(Open NetEnvironment)体系。
J2SE就是J***a2的标准版,主要用于桌面应用软件的编程;J2ME主要应用于嵌入式系统开发,如手机和PDA的编程;J2EE是J***a2的企业版,主要用于分布式的网络程序的开发,如电子商务网站和ERP系统。
J***a具有简单性、面向对象、分布式、健壮性、安全性、平***立与可移植性、多线程、动态性等特点。
J***a可以编写桌面应用程序、Web应用程序、分布式系统和嵌入式系统应用程序等。
到此,以上就是小编对于J***A编程数字全部排列顺序的问题就介绍到这了,希望介绍关于J***A编程数字全部排列顺序的4点解答对大家有用。